With multiple macabre scenes, talented scare actors, and detailed sets, we’re waiting to terrify you inside our bone chilling walls! No actor will touch you, so please be respectful and refrain from touching them. The recommended age for our main haunted attractions is 10 plus. However, we trust parents to know what their children will enjoy.

If a regular haunted house leaves you wanting more try our 18 plus nights. It’s our main Halloween Show PLUS! Our actors WILL touch, grab, and engage you in more intense interactions. Must be 18 to attend and present a valid driver’s license or state ID. October 5, 12 and 26.

We also offer other haunts throughout the year: Yule Scream in December, Cupid's Revenge in February, and more.

  • Email Verified 18+ is where it's at!

    I went to both the all ages and 18+ nights and enjoyed them both. The 18+ was a "better" experience imo. A more bang for your buck. The 18+ haunt is a truly an immersive experience, where the actors engage you into the moment. It's full contact but nothing questionable, nor extreme at all. I don' want to give too much away because I think going in blind will give you the best time. However, for example there was a moment when the actor made us sing a song to appease the creepy clown in order to move on. That was both fun. and hilarious. It's definitely best to go along with the haunt. Allow yourself to play along, It just makes the whole immersive experience that much better. The traditional night was fun too, but pretty standard. The actors will focus more on jump scares, with zero contact (purposefully speaking). I definitely recommend Nowhere Haunted Hause. There's a small arcade and mini golf which are cool additions especially for younger kids. I do believe there's some finger food like pizza, hot dog, and chicken fingers but I'm not 100%. I do know they snacks though! Only reason I gave it 4 pumpkins and not five is because once you've gone through, it's hard to be surprised again. I would also add a bit more adult themes, content, and or language to the 18+ nights. Just give that age requirement a real purpose. Hope that makes sense.
